Output 31ba81744cdbb4cbadb5ead46668d1ff189bf41168df8dee3aef84473a1e684e:1

value
13243286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85d3db86bc9881271d93d04e1a32199864f9aba OP_EQUAL
address
3QLFCd4bRmPBT1iNL6F39UtxTsp9gQsQgX
transaction
31ba81744cdbb4cbadb5ead46668d1ff189bf41168df8dee3aef84473a1e684e